A deliveryman in the anime

The deliveryman is an NPC who supplies the player items or Pokémon throughout each game since Generation II.

In the games

The deliveryman has appeared in every game since Pokémon Gold and Silver. In the Generation II, III, IV, V, and VII games, the NPC is male. In the Generation VI games, the NPC is female.

In the Generation II games, he is found at Pokémon Center 2F on the leftmost counter next to the PC. In Pokémon FireRed, LeafGreen, and Emerald, he is found on the second floor of Pokémon Centers next to Teala. In the Generation IV games, he is found at Poké Marts by the counter. In the Generation V games, he is found inside Pokémon Centers, near the entry point. In both the Generation VI and VII games, they are found at Pokémon Centers by the receptionist's counter on the left side.

The deliveryman has also appeared in Pokémon HeartGold & SoulSilver where he will deliver the player a range of items from the player's Mom, such as Potions, Berries, and battle items like the Macho Brace, which she buys when the player's savings reach certain points.

In the anime

A deliveryman appeared in The Dex Can't Help It!. He delivered a washing machine to Professor Kukui's house but later returned as the washing machine was for Nurse Joy and took it, unaware that it was inhabited by the Rotom that was inhabiting Rotom Pokédex and delivered it to the Pokémon Center.

In the manga

In the Be the Best! Pokémon B+W manga

 
A deliveryman in Be the Best! Pokémon B+W

A deliveryman appeared in Victini - A New Friend!. Monta went inside a Pokémon Center where the deliveryman was waiting and the deliveryman gave Monta a Victini.
